Light 

A great thing to consider in your home to make it more comfortable is the light. This will not only make it more comfortable but also help boost your mental well-being, make your home brighter, and help save on bills. This is great during the summer when you spend time indoors, so you can have the best of both worlds. It is also excellent during the winter when the days are already quite dark. Letting in more natural light helps connect you more to nature. See where you can move your furniture around to let in more light. You may also consider the size of your windows, adding clear glass to your doors, installing a skylight and even opening up walls and rooms.


Air

Depending on where you live, you will need to consider heating and cooling systems, as well as the condition of the air in your home. You might consider air purifiers. You should also find ways to efficiently cool down or warm up your home throughout different seasons of the year. The quality of air and the temperature can make a huge difference.
